Output dd113de00a87dbf80781384f4360f9a54fe1edeae4c982ae2bdc7f1adcf4910a:1

value
1038943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98fcd160cbfc754430217f6949cd7ea75ecfba85 OP_EQUAL
address
3FdwVo9YcihgDA4zeyvekGp4nS4ms41AQQ
transaction
dd113de00a87dbf80781384f4360f9a54fe1edeae4c982ae2bdc7f1adcf4910a
confirmations
318659
spent
true